Output 0735cbd91684f60485c9b38988659b116eb0358120a1a6b122a890f88062f874:36

value
29669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0d87652b7aa719b7afef1bc20439dcc415042f1 OP_EQUAL
address
3GMVMJ11idWjCcPQraC8mVGHBUxM4kbEvg
transaction
0735cbd91684f60485c9b38988659b116eb0358120a1a6b122a890f88062f874
confirmations
142159
spent
true